Boeing NKC-135A Stratotanker

In one of the great ironies of aviation history, the KC-135 Stratotanker, the most successful aerial tanker ever built, was never meant to serve more than ten years, let alone the over fifty it has. With jet bombers such as the B-47 and B-52 coming into service, Strategic Air Command’s fleet of KB-29s and KC-97s clearly would not be adequate—an all-jet tanker was needed as well. Lockheed won the USAF competition in 1954 with its L-193 proposal, but it would be some time before the L-193 would be operational.

 

Needing jet tankers immediately, the USAF turned to Boeing, which already had a four-engined jet transport flying—the Model 367 “Dash 80” private-venture demonstrator. Boeing, since it was already producing both the B-47 and the B-52, as well as the KC-97, had no trouble convincing the USAF that the Dash 80 could be converted to the tanker role, and the USAF duly ordered 250 “interim” KC-135As until the L-193 could come online.

 

In the end, the L-193 never made it off the drawing board: the KC-135 was easy to fly, easy to operate, and had all the speed and range necessary for its mission. The 250 “interim” aircraft would grow to a final order of over 800 airframes. In the process, the KC-135’s success also ensured that airlines took a closer look at the Dash 80, which resulted in an upscaled version: the very successful 707. The KC-135A was and remains often confused with the 707, which is larger and wider than the tanker; further complicating the issue is many air forces converting retired 707-320 airliners to essentially KC-135 standard.

 

The KC-135A Stratotanker entered service in June 1957, having first flown the year before. Immediately it showed itself to be a vast improvement over piston-engined tankers in speed and ability to transfer fuel. Because it used the same jet propulsion as the B-47 and B-52, it did not need double fuel systems as the KC-97 did; in a pinch, the KC-135 could even transfer some of its own fuel if necessary. It revolutionized air refuelling technology and nuclear attack strategy, as KC-135s could reach station behind the “fail-safe” line quickly if the B-52s needed to remain longer.

 

Though SAC had always intended the KC-135 to be exclusively for the refuelling of its bomber force, the Vietnam War was to bring the KC-135 into the tactical role as well. Jet fighters used over Vietnam, namely the F-105 Thunderchief and F-4 Phantom II, had the range to reach North Vietnam from bases in Thailand, but once there would have almost no fuel and could not carry any ordnance worth the trip. By deploying KC-135s to “anchor tracks” over Laos and the Gulf of Tonkin under Operation Young Tiger, SAC tanker crews could refuel the F-105 strike aircraft and their F-4 escorts before they crossed into hostile territory, allowing the fighters to have the fuel necessary for extended operations, and carry heavy ordnance loads. Vietnam proved that the Stratotanker was more than useful in the tactical strike role, and though the tankers remained under the control of SAC until 1991, they were to prove vital again and again worldwide in trouble spots. Without tanker support, missions over both North Vietnam and Iraq would have been near impossible—leading to the famous tanker crew motto: “No one kicks ass without tanker gas.”

 

By the 1980s, the KC-135A fleet was aging and there was no replacement in sight. The JT3D turbojets used by the A model was very loud, left clouds of brown smoke when its water injection was used, and was not as fuel efficient as later turbofans. This was partially mitigated by converting 161 aircraft to KC-135Es, using TF33 turbofans removed from retired 707s, but this was only a partial solution. The USAF decided to convert most of the fleet to KC-135R standard, though a few high-time “stovepipe” KC-135As remained in service into the early 1990s and saw action during the First Gulf War before being retired.

 

55-3131 was originally constructed as a KC-135A, but in 1960, it was converted to a JKC-135A (later NKC-135A) testbed aircraft. It was used to test radio wave function at high altitude, as well as the ionosphere, using sensors and cameras; the latter gained her the nickname (and later nose art) of "Aurora Explorer." 55-3131 was later fitted with a dummy fuselage radome to test the feasilbility of the E-3 Sentry proposal, and was also used in testing materials used in the KC-135R program. It was withdrawn from service in 1992, having spent its entire career with the 4950th Test Wing at Wright-Patterson AFB, Ohio, and was scrapped in 2010.

 

Though later 55-3131 was painted white over gray, the same scheme as Military Airlift Command in the 1970s, in the 1960s it was still bare metal. Where this picture was taken is unknown, but 55-3131 shows the various aerials and domes used in its role as a NKC-135.
